首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

加速数据库的查询速度

加速数据库的查询速度是指通过优化数据库配置、使用索引、优化查询语句等方法来提高数据库查询速度。这是数据库性能优化的一个重要方面,可以提高应用程序的响应速度和用户体验。

在云计算中,可以使用腾讯云的数据库产品来加速数据库的查询速度。腾讯云提供了多种数据库产品,包括关系型数据库、非关系型数据库和内存数据库等。这些数据库产品都支持数据库的优化和查询加速,可以帮助用户提高数据库的性能和稳定性。

以下是腾讯云提供的一些数据库产品:

  • 关系型数据库:包括MySQL、SQL Server和PostgreSQL等,可以通过优化数据库配置、使用索引、优化查询语句等方法来提高数据库查询速度。
  • 非关系型数据库:包括MongoDB、Cassandra和Redis等,可以通过优化数据库配置、使用索引、优化查询语句等方法来提高数据库查询速度。
  • 内存数据库:包括Memcached和Redis等,可以通过优化数据库配置、使用索引、优化查询语句等方法来提高数据库查询速度。

除了上述数据库产品外,腾讯云还提供了一些其他的数据库服务,例如数据库备份和恢复、数据库监控和告警等,可以帮助用户更好地管理和维护数据库。

总之,腾讯云提供了多种数据库产品和服务,可以帮助用户加速数据库的查询速度,提高应用程序的性能和稳定性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Redis使用Pipeline加速查询速度

这意味着通常情况下 Redis 客户端执行一条命令分为如下四个过程: 发送命令 命令排队 命令执行 返回结果 客户端向服务端发送一个查询请求,并监听Socket返回,通常是以阻塞模式,等待服务端响应。...如果使用是本地环回接口,RTT 就短得多,但如如果需要连续执行多次写入,这也是一笔很大开销。 下面我们看一下执行 N 次命令模型: ? 2....我们可以从上表中得出如下结论: Pipeline 执行速度一般比逐条执行要快。 客户端和服务端网络延时越大,Pipeline 效果越明显。 5....批量命令与Pipeline对比 下面我们看一下批量命令与 Pipeline 区别: 原生批量命令是原子,Pipeline 是非原子。...注意点 使用 Pipeline 发送命令时,每次 Pipeline 组装命令个数不能没有节制,否则一次组装命令数据量过大,一方面会增加客户端等待时间,另一方面会造成一定网络阻塞,可以将一次包含大量命令

1.9K30

提高数据库查询速度几个思路

2、数据库大字段剥离,保证单条记录数据量很小。 3、恰当地使用索引。 4、必要时建立多级索引。...5、分析Oracle执行计划,通过表数据统计等方式协助数据库走正确查询方式,该走索引就走索引,该走全表扫描就走全表扫描。...6、表分区和拆分,无论是业务逻辑上拆分(如一个月一张报表、分库)还是无业务含义分区(如根据ID取模分区)。 7、RAC。 8、字段冗余,减少跨库查询和大表连接操作。...9、数据通过单个或多个JOB生成出来,减少实时查询。 10、从磁盘上做文章,数据存放在磁盘内、外磁道上,数据获取效率都是不一样。 11、放弃关系数据库某些特性,引入NoSQL数据库。...12、换种思路存放数据,例如搜索中倒排表。

1.4K80
  • 提高数据库查询速度几个思路

    2、数据库大字段剥离,保证单条记录数据量很小。 3、恰当地使用索引。 4、必要时建立多级索引。...5、分析 Oracle 执行计划,通过表数据统计等方式协助数据库走正确查询方式,该走索引就走索引,该走全表扫描就走全表扫描。...6、表分区和拆分,无论是业务逻辑上拆分(如一个月一张报表、分库)还是无业务含义分区(如根据 ID 取模分区)。...7、RAC,值得注意是,Oracle RAC 在节点较多时有其不可解决性能问题。 8、字段冗余,减少跨库查询和大表连接操作。 9、数据通过单个或多个 JOB 生成出来,减少实时查询。...10、从磁盘上做文章,数据存放在磁盘内、外磁道上,数据获取效率都是不一样。 11、放弃关系数据库某些特性,引入 NoSQL 数据库。 12、换种思路存放数据,例如搜索中倒排表。

    1.1K10

    什么影响了数据库查询速度?

    来源:http://t.cn/RnU0h2o 1 影响数据库查询速度四个因素 2 风险分析 3 网卡流量:如何避免无法连接数据库情况 4 大表带来问题(重要) 5 大事务带来问题(重要) ---...- 1 影响数据库查询速度四个因素 ?...2 风险分析 QPS:Queries Per Second意思是“每秒查询率”,是一台服务器每秒能够相应查询次数,是对一个特定查询服务器在规定时间内所处理流量多少衡量标准。...3 网卡流量:如何避免无法连接数据库情况 减少从服务器数量(从服务器会从主服务器复制日志) 进行分级缓存(避免前端大量缓存失效) 避免使用select * 进行查询 分离业务网络和服务器网络 4 大表带来问题...:会造成长时间主从延迟('480秒延迟') 4.3 如何处理数据库大表 分库分表把一张大表分成多个小表 难点: 分表主键选择 分表后跨分区数据查询和统计 5 大事务带来问题(重要) 5.1

    1.6K20

    数据库查询速度优化之解决技巧

    从这两种方式查询数据库结果看,建立索引之后查询速度提高了些,现在数据量还不明显,如果表中有10万条速度,差异就会很明显了. 2、写数据语句时尽可能减少表全局扫描 1)减少where 字段值null判断...SQL是根据表中数据来进行查询优化,当索引列有大量数据重复时,SQL查询可能不会去利用索引,如一表中有字段sex,male、female几乎各一半,那么即使在sex上建了索引也对查询效率起不了作用...6、创建数据库时应该注意地方 1)尽可能使用 varchar/nvarchar 代替 char/nchar 因为首先变长字段存储空间小,可以节省存储空间,其次对于查询来说,在一个相对较小字段内搜索效率显然要高些...对小型数据集使用 FAST_FORWARD 游标通常要优于其他逐行处理方法,尤其是在必须引用几个表才能获得所需数据时。在结果集中包括“合计”例程通常要比使用游标执行速度快。...作者: 曹理鹏@iCocos 链接:https://icocos.github.io/2019/03/11/数据库查询速度优化之解决技巧/

    1.1K20

    加速ubuntu开机速度

    t=7505 原作者i3dmaster 译者yang119345 加速Ubuntu开机过程 此HowTo 适合抱怨ubuntu启动速度相当慢但不愿意安装任何可选择工具提速的人群。...下面的做一切是通过调整Ubuntu开机进程,因为每人计算机 有所不同,存在一些风险——下面的一些东西可能损坏你系统。 在你更改之前,做出你判断并为/etc目录作一个备份总是好。...** 此HowTo建议: 1. 我希望你能从中学到东西而不是仅仅简单拷贝。 因此请, **不要 ** 完全地按照我所作并复制到你计算机。阅读服务描述并自己判断去决定是否需要保留他们。...在我情况里,我是关掉它。 61. hwtools – 一个优化irqs工具。不确定打开它好处。在我情况里,我是关掉它。...**更新**: 加速/打扫系统重启或关机进程 1. 通过以下代码运行sysv-rc-conf: 代码: sudo sysv-rc-conf 2.

    1.6K20

    mongovue查询字段_mongodb查询速度

    (fromdb,todb,fromhost)  复制数据库fromdb—源数据库名称,todb—目标数据库名称,fromhost—源数据库服务器地址 db.createCollection(name,...   返回符合条件一条数据 db.linlin.getDB()    返回此数据集所属数据库名称 db.linlin.getIndexes()     返回些数据集索引信息 db.linlin.group...MongoDB好处挺多,比如多列索引,查询时可以用一些统计函数,支持多条件查询,但是目前多表查询是不支持,可以想办法通过数据冗余来解决多表 查询问题。...=3 and k>10 查询不包括某内容 db.colls.find({}, {a:0});//查询除a为0外所有数据 支持, >=查询,需用符号替代分别为$lt,$lte,$gt...$size查询 db.colls.find( { a : { $size: 1 } } );//对对象数量查询,此查询查询a子对象数目为1记录 $exists查询 db.colls.find

    2.4K20

    加速Github访问及下载速度

    Github痛 国内访问github速度一直被广大网友及开发者所诟病,为了缓解这一现象,本文介绍几种方式加速,由于中国开发者人群越来越大,github也被微软收购,相信这个问题今后肯定会慢慢被解决...如果你有一个速度还不错代理,就不需要再使用下面的方案了....配置完成后就可以了,此方式速度提升不固定,有较大波动,同样,对于其他打开速度缓慢域名都可以使用这种方式,但是如果确定不使用了最好记得清楚那条记录,免得起到干扰作用 访问加速,使用镜像站 github...://github.com/Molunerfinn/PicGo.git #原链接 git clone https://hub.fastgit.org/Molunerfinn/PicGo.git #加速链接...下载站加速下载 通常我们需要下载release里源码或者编译好程序,但是如果使用前面的方法,下载链接是一样,所以速度依旧无法提升.

    4.1K31

    如何提升 MySQL 查询速度

    前言 MySQL是一种常用关系型数据库管理系统,对于大规模数据操作和查询查询速度优化至关重要。本文将介绍如何提升MySQL查询速度,包括优化数据库结构、优化查询语句以及配置和优化服务器。...优化数据库结构 1 使用合适数据类型 选择适合存储数据数据类型,避免使用过大或不必要数据类型,可以减少磁盘空间和内存消耗。 2 创建索引 根据查询需求和频率创建合适索引,可以加快查询速度。...索引可以在WHERE和ORDER BY子句中起到加速查询作用。 3 规范化数据 规范化数据库结构,将重复数据拆分成多个表,减少数据冗余,提高查询效率。...总结 通过优化数据库结构、优化查询语句和配置和优化服务器,可以提升MySQL查询速度。合理选择数据类型、创建索引、规范化数据结构可以减少数据冗余和提高查询效率。...综合应用这些优化技巧,可以显著提升MySQL查询速度,提升系统性能和响应能力。

    57920

    提高查询数据速度

    在实际项目中,通过设计表架构时,设计系统结构时,查询数据时综合提高查询数据效率 1.适当冗余 数据库在设计时遵守三范式,同时业务数据(对数据操作,比如资料审核,对某人评分等)和基础数据(比如资料详情...在设计数据库时,三范式能够最大限度节省 数据库存储所需空间,可是缺点是 在查询,修改等操作时,会造成查询缓慢,效率低下。...比如 国家免检产品,在保证产品质量(本表)前提下,充分相信制造商(外键对应表) 4.使用redis缓存机制 对于重复查询,没有改变数据,可以使用redis缓存机制,直接访问内存数据,不再访问数据库...,减少访问数据库时间(数据库在硬盘上,redis缓存在内存中)。...思路是:读取数据库数据到redis缓存中,从redis中取数据给前端。如果涉及到数据修改不大,可以修改到redis中,固定时间同步到数据库,保证数据统一完整性。

    1.5K80

    SQL 查询优化:为何 SELECT * 会拖慢你数据库速度

    二、SELECT * 会导致查询效率低原因2.1、数据库引擎查询流程数据库引擎查询流程通常包含以下几个步骤:解析 SQL 语句:数据库引擎先将 SQL 语句解析成内部执行计划,包括了查询哪些数据表...优化查询计划:数据库引擎对内部执行计划进行优化,根据查询复杂度、数据量和系统资源等因素,选择最优执行计划。...缓存查询结果:如果查询结果集比较大或者查询频率较高,数据库引擎会将查询结果缓存在内存中,以加速后续查询操作。...执行查询计划:根据执行计划,数据库引擎会扫描相应数据表,读取所有的列和行数据,然后将这些数据传输到客户端。数据传输到客户端:一旦查询完成,数据库引擎将查询结果集发送到客户端,包括所有的列和行数据。...数据冗余:使用 SELECT * 查询语句可能会查询出不必要重复数据,增加数据库存储空间,降低数据库性能。

    48110

    解释凸轮速度加速度曲线含义

    根据位置曲线含义,初学者很容易认为速度曲线是主从轴速度对应关系,加速度曲线是主从轴加速度对应关系,但实际真的是这样吗?...与主轴速度没有直接关系。 2.2 加速度曲线分析 在加速度曲线中,横坐标是x,纵坐标是 。 图2-2 加速度曲线 同样通过数学公式分析加速度曲线。...加速度是位置对时间2阶导数,凸轮从轴位置函数为f(x(t)),所以凸轮从轴加速度为: 式2-2凸轮从轴加速度 式中 是主轴速度, 是主轴加速度, 是从轴位置对主轴位置导数, 是从轴位置对主轴位置...只要位置曲线向下弯曲,加速度就是负值,并且位置曲线弯曲越厉害加速度越小;反之只要位置曲线向上弯曲加速度就是正值,并且曲线弯曲越厉害加速度越大。...所以加速度曲线是位置曲线曲率,与主轴加速度没有直接关系。加加速曲线分析与速度曲线及加速度曲线分析类似,有兴趣读者可以自己推导一下,本文就不多说了。

    3.7K20

    Mysql和Redis查询速度对比

    “ 在软件系统中,IO速度比内存速度慢,IO读写在很多情况下会是系统瓶颈,我们也知道Redis查询速度比直接查数据库要快,因为Redis将数据存在内存中,而Mysql查询是执行IO操作。...今天给大家带来是,Mysql和Redis在项目中查询速度差距。 01 — 实例 首先我们看一张图片: ?...最后他们值是相同,我已经将数据库返回数据存到Redis中。...也就是说100ms左右加载速度,人眼看到基本上就是秒加载了。 这里对比并不是说Mysql不好,而且这个对比也是有一定问题,因为本人SQL查询语句可能优化并不是特别好。...好了,既然我们知道Redis查询速度要比直接查询Mysql要快,那么如何合理在项目中运用Redis呢?请继续关明天文章,今天就讲到这里,希望大家能有一个充实一周。

    5.7K10

    如何优化大表查询速度

    1.如何优化查询速度?所谓“大表”指的是一张表中有大量数据,而通常情况下数据量越多,那么也就意味着查询速度越慢。...那问题来了,怎么优化查询速度呢?这个问题主要优化方案有以下几个。1.1 创建适当索引通过创建适当索引,可以加速查询操作。...可以优化查询条件,使用合适索引、合理查询策略,减少不必要字段和数据返回。1.3 缓存查询结果对于一些相对稳定查询结果,可以将其缓存在内存中,避免重复查询数据库,提高查询速度。...缓存查询速度一定比直接查询数据库效率高,这是因为缓存具备以下特征:内存访问速度快:缓存通常将数据存储在内存中,而数据库将数据存储在磁盘上。...相比于磁盘访问,内存访问速度更快,可以达到纳秒级别的读取速度,远远快于数据库毫秒级别的读取速度。IO 操作次数少:数据库通常需要进行磁盘 IO 操作,包括读取和写入磁盘数据。

    41900

    TinyBERT 蒸馏速度实现加速小记

    ---- 编辑:AI算法小喵 写在前面 最近做一个 project 需要复现 EMNLP 2020 Findings TinyBERT[1],本文是对复现过程对踩到坑,以及对应解决方案和实现加速一个记录...在内存消耗方面,一系列知识蒸馏工作,例如 DistilBERT[2]、BERT-PKD[3] 和 TinyBERT 被提出来用以降低模型参数(主要是层数)以及相应地减少时间; 在推理加速方面,也有...对于一些小数据集像 MRPC,增广 20 倍之后数据量依旧是 80k 不到,因此训练速度还是很快,20 轮单卡大概半天也能跑完。...Acceleration of Data Loading 我先试了少量数据,降采样到 10k,程序运行没问题, DDP 速度很快;我再尝试了单卡加载,虽然又 load 了一个小时,但是 ok,程序还是能跑起来...此外,为了进一步加速,我还把混合精度也整合了进来,现在 Pytorch 以及自带对混合精度支持,代码量也很少,但是有个坑就是loss 计算必须被 auto() 包裹住,同时,所有模型输出都要参与到

    82520

    mysql索引提高查询速度

    使用索引提高查询速度 1.前言   在web开发中,业务模版,业务逻辑(包括缓存、连接池)和数据库这三个部分,数据库在其中负责执行SQL查询并返回查询结果,是影响网站速度最重要性能瓶颈。...本文主要针对Mysql数据库,在淘宝去IOE(I 代表IBM缩写,即去IBM存储设备和小型机;O是代表Oracle缩写,去Oracle数据库,采用Mysql和Hadoop代替;E是代表EMC2,...而优化数据重要一步就是索引建立,对于Mysql出现查询,可以用索引提升查询速度。...,数据库利用各种各样快速定位技术,能够大大提高查询效率。...特别是当数据量非常大,查询涉及多个表时,使用索引往往能使查询速度加快成千上万倍。

    3.5K30
    领券